Graham Charles Savory (born 11 October 1960), is a male former athlete who competed for England. [1]
Savory was twice British discus throw champion after winning the 1986 UK Athletics Championships and 1989 UK Athletics Championships. He was also twice a silver medal winner at the AAA Championships. [2] [3]
He represented England in the discus and shot put events, at the 1986 Commonwealth Games in Edinburgh, Scotland. [4] [5] Four years later he represented England in the discus event, at the 1990 Commonwealth Games in Auckland, New Zealand. [6] [7] [8]
